基于预测控制的结构振动半主动控制研究
Study of semi-active control of structure based on predictive control
【摘要】 建立了半主动控制系统的理论模型,分析了半主动控制机理,并结合现代控制理论,将预测控制应用于结构半主动控制中,提出了在线预测控制算法,建立了预测模型,并成功的解决了时滞问题,最后作了计算机仿真分析,证明该系统有较好的控制效果。将预测控制思想应用于结构半主动控制中,为结构控制注入了新的思路,通过研究及仿真分析也说明了这种思想是可行的并且具有很大的发展前途。
【Abstract】 In this paper, a semiactive control system is proposed and its control theory is analyzed. Predictive control which combines modern control theory, is applied to the semiactive control system of structurel in earthquake engineering. The algorithm of online predictive control is developed. The model of predictive control is set up ,and a method that solves timedelay problem based on predictive control is presented . The computed control result has proved fully that the method is correct and practical. In this paper the conception of predictive control is applied to the semiactive control of structure,and a new way of structure control is found. The study and simulation result have shown that this conception is applicability and has a good future.
【Key words】 semi-active control; predictive model; time-delay; computer simulation;
